output statement overflows record error
Dear all,
I am trying to run the yambo exmaple(http://www.yambo-code.org/tutorials/GW/index.php).
By this tutorial, I run step a (yambo), step b (yambo -x -F INPUTS/01HF_corrections), step c (yambo -F INPUTS/01HF_corrections -J HF_7Ry).
Step a and b are ok. But Step c has the following errors.
<---> [01] Files & I/O Directories
<---> [02] CORE Variables Setup
<---> [02.01] Unit cells
<---> [02.02] Symmetries
<---> [02.03] RL shells
<---> [02.04] K-grid lattice
<---> [02.05] Energies [ev] & Occupations
<---> [03] Transferred momenta grid
<---> [04] Bare local and non-local Exchange-Correlation
<---> [FFT-HF/Rho] Mesh size: 12 12 12
<---> [WF-HF/Rho loader] Wfs (re)loading |####################| [100%] --(E) --(X)
<---> EXS |####################| [100%] --(E) --(X)forrtl: severe (66): output statement overflows record, unit -5, file Internal Formatted Write
Yambo is compiled by ifort + mkl with a version 3.2.5. Any reply will be much appreciated.

two issues:
1) after the p2y interface, yo need to run a setup (yambo -i) to generate input file and then run yambo.
2) In you ypp input the band range is missing e.g.:
Code: Select all
(% BANDS_range #
4 | 5 | # Bands Range
%
You can have a look the example here.
